AbstractStudy of heterogeneous catalysts by modern surface analysis methods. The past decade has been one of tempestuous development in methods of surface analysis as a result of significant improvements of vacuum techniques and electronic components. The principal methods available for studying the chemical composition of catalysts are ESCA, Auger spectroscopy, ISS (ion scattering spectroscopy), and SIMS (secondary ion mass spectrometry). The “classical scanning microscope” and various “micro‐range” analyzers, e. g. the scanning Auger microscope, permit elucidation of catalyst surface structures.
